Sub-Saharan Africa, particularly East Africa's economic hub—Kenya, is experiencing a major transition in public health and nutritional awareness. Urbanization in key metropolises like Nairobi, Mombasa, Nakuru, and Kisumu has altered lifestyle and dietary structures. While traditional Kenyan diets rich in unrefined grains (like brown ugali, traditional greens, and legumes) naturally provided abundant fiber, modern urban lifestyles have shifted consumption toward convenience foods. This dietary transition has resulted in an increasing prevalence of digestive challenges, irregular bowel movements, and metabolic syndromes among urban professionals and kids.
Consequently, the retail market for vitamins, minerals, and supplements (VMS) is expanding at an unprecedented rate. According to health sector distributors in East Africa, modern consumers are moving away from hard tablets and bitter powders in favor of convenient, great-tasting, and highly bioavailable functional foods—principally supplement gummies. Fiber supplement gummies containing chicory root inulin, fructooligosaccharides (FOS), and apple pectin represent one of the fastest-growing categories in leading pharmacy chains such as Goodlife Pharmacy, MyDawa, and major retail outlets like Carrefour and Naivas.
For importers and distributors shipping dietary supplements to East Africa, ambient temperature control is a significant challenge. Products shipped via the Port of Mombasa and distributed inland by truck are often subjected to temperatures exceeding 35°C, accompanied by high humidity. Standard gelatin-based gummies melt at approximately 35°C, causing them to fuse into a single mass inside the bottle before reaching retail shelves.
As an expert OEM/ODM partner, Guangdong Eik Health Co., Ltd. resolves this critical logistical pain point by utilizing advanced citrus and apple pectin-based structural bases. Pectin, a plant-derived soluble fiber, possesses a much higher melting point (up to 85°C) and structural resilience compared to animal-based gelatin.

Entering the Kenyan health and wellness sector requires strict adherence to local regulatory frameworks. Supplement products cannot clear customs or be legally distributed without appropriate quality verification. Guangdong Eik Health Co., Ltd. works collaboratively with partners to ensure smooth clearing processes by preparing necessary technical documents at the point of manufacture.
Under the Pre-Export Verification of Conformity (PVoC) to Standards program, imports to Kenya must undergo assessment prior to shipment. We assist importers by providing comprehensive Certificate of Analysis (COA) documents, microbiological stability reports, and heavy metal testing profiles. This ensures that third-party inspection firms (like SGS, Intertek, or Bureau Veritas in China) can seamlessly issue the mandatory Certificate of Conformity (CoC).
Health supplements and functional foods containing therapeutic claims may require product listing or approval by the Pharmacy and Poisons Board (PPB) in Kenya. We supply standard-compliant ingredient declarations and factory GMP certifications to facilitate this process.
